Hello Figma Community,

I’m currently a design student and I was re-verifying my student education plan because of the new update and features but when I tried to re-verify my account, my ending screen would be

Verification Limit Exceeded

We're glad you're enthusiastic, but it looks like you've already redeemed or attempted to redeem this offer.

I don’t know if my re-verification went through because before it would say “we’re having troubles please verify later” so I tried it a couple of days later and got the “verification limit exceeded” screen.

 

If anyone knows a solution that would be amazing! Thanks!

Hi ​@Eduardo Ribeiro — welcome to Figma Forum, and sorry about the trouble with re-verifying.

The "Verification Limit Exceeded" message is coming from SheerID, the partner who manages the verification process. It usually means your verification attempts have been capped — but SheerID has the tools to reset that limit so you can try again. Here's what I'd suggest:

  1. Reach out to SheerID directly at figmasupport@sheerid.com — let them know you hit the limit while re-verifying for the new update, and they should be able to reset your attempts.
  2. Before you re-verify, make sure you have the right documentation ready based on your institution type. This resource covers what's required: Figma for Education → Verify your education status.
